SOC code 39-9032
There have been 47 US Department of Labor LCA filings for Recreation Workers on the E-3 visa across all available fiscal years, with 76.6% certified. The median annualized wage is $43,465. The top sponsor is International Sports Training Camp, with most positions based in PA.

Can Australians work as recreation workers on the E-3 visa?
Yes. The E-3 visa is exclusive to Australian citizens and is one of the most common visa categories for skilled professionals working in the United States. Recreation Workers is regularly sponsored under the E-3 visa, as the data on this page shows.
